The normal pulse rate for an adult typically falls within the range of 60 to 100 beats per minute, with some sources extending the upper limit to 110 or 120 beats per minute. So, the statement is generally true. However, individual variations and circumstances can cause pulse rates outside this range, so it's important to consider the context and individual health when assessing pulse rates.
